We are seeking a skilled Manufacturing Test Software Engineer with strong expertise in C/C++/C# to develop and maintain automated test solutions for PCBA functional and end‑of‑line (EOL) testing. The ideal candidate will work cross‑functionally with hardware, firmware, and systems teams to ensure robust test coverage, high production yield, and efficient manufacturing operations.
Key Responsibilities- Develop, maintain, and optimize manufacturing test software for automated test equipment supporting PCBA functional and EOL testing
- Integrate software with hardware interfaces, instrumentation, and communication protocols
- Collaborate with hardware, firmware, and systems engineering teams to ensure Design for Test (DFT) and comprehensive test coverage
- Support deployment, debugging, and sustaining of test systems across internal and contract manufacturing sites
- Improve test uptime, cycle time, and production yield through continuous software enhancements
- Implement automated data collection, logging, and analytics to identify anomalies and prevent production escapes
- Participate in root cause analysis of production issues and deliver long-term, software‑driven solutions
- Create and maintain documentation for software architecture, test procedures, and troubleshooting guides
